Marine Biologist: Focuses on studying marine organisms and ecosystems, contributing to sustainable practices in fisheries management.
Fisheries Manager: Oversees the sustainable operation of fisheries, ensuring compliance with environmental regulations and promoting best practices.
Aquaculture Technician: Works in fish farming operations, implementing sustainable techniques to enhance fish production while minimizing environmental impact.
Sustainability Consultant: Advises organizations on best practices and strategies for sustainable fishing, aiming to balance economic and environmental goals.
Research Scientist: Conducts studies on fish populations and ecosystems to inform policy and management decisions in the field of sustainable fisheries.
Data Analyst: Analyzes data related to fish stocks, market trends, and environmental impacts to support decision-making in sustainable fisheries management.
